Kingston House specializes in modern Australian cuisine that showcases fresh, local ingredients. Their lunch specials — offered Wednesday to Friday from 11am to 4pm — are a standout feature, priced at an incredible $32, which includes a beverage of your choice, from house wine to soft drinks. Among the must-try dishes are the slow roasted porterhouse, served with a delectable bacon, mushroom, and rosemary Yorkshire pudding, or the pan-roasted Humpty Doo barramundi, a symphony of flavors with its crunchy potato and leek rosti and velvety garlic cream. For those craving something a bit different, the Cajun chicken served with corn rib salad and heirloom tomatoes is a vibrant, textural delight that awakens the palate.
